6 Record Creation Load Federal ISIR records and/or CSS Profile records to temporary tables Use Common Matching to match records to existing General Person records Resolve suspended records Uses Common Matching Process Designate unmatched records as New or Hold Load Matched and New records to permanent tables online or in batch Delete Records from temporary tables in batch or on-line Print ISIR records as desired 6

8 Needs Analysis Institutional Methodology Processing Set IM options on RNRGLxx Global Options Form Run RNEINxx CSS Institutional Needs Analysis Process (INAS) in batch after each data load if using local global options Print INAR and/or FM/IM Comparison Report as desired Run RCPIMFM Copy IM to FM Process to move unique IM values to current FM record for use in rules and population selections Non-Profile schools use Copy FM to IM option and run\ RNEINxx. 8

9 Needs Analysis Verification Professional Judgment Processing Enter changes on RNANAxx, RNAPRxx, RNAOVxx, RNAVRxx Needs Analysis Forms Run on-line RNEINxx The CSS Institutional Needs Analysis Process (INAS) to recalculate EFC Professional Judgments Perform and save need analysis simulations on RNAPRxx OR Enter changes on RNANAxx, RNAOVxx Run on-line RNEINxx CSS INAS to recalculate EFC 9

10 Requirements Tracking Verification Requirements Automatic assignment via grouping process Run in batch after each dataload or on-line for single applicant Comment Code Resolution Requirements Assign automatically using population selection and batch posting Fund-Specific Requirements Automatic posting during award packaging Title IV authorization interface to Banner AR System Manual and Mass-Entered Requirements Enter selected documents on RRAAREQ, RRAMASS, ROARMAN Forms 10

14 Budgeting Create Campus-Based, Institutional, Pell Budgets Use proration or build all budgets Assign budgets to students via batch grouping or online Modify budgets for professional judgment Mix budgets to accommodate varying enrollment patterns 14

16 Packaging Self-adjusting Pell Grant awarding Autopackaging via packaging groups Simulated or actual process with reports Batch or online immediate process Apply equity, gap, self-help, or fund limit strategies Award via batch-posting or manual entry Separate outside resource form entries reduce need Third-party contract and exemptions interface from Banner AR System Packaging validation and overaward reports provided 16

20 Disbursement Batch or online disbursement process Three disbursement levels memo, authorization, payment Use ISIR Expected Enrollment or actual enrollment Runs online from Banner Financial Aid or AR system Utilizes Just-in-Time Pell processing Pre-disbursement validation process and report Capture frozen enrollment for term - RSRENRL Nontraditional disbursement options Pay based on student attendance pattern Update scheduled disbursement date per student enrollment start date for term 20

28 Electronic Loans Create application form in batch or online Certify applications per Student System calculated class level Update Banner unique loan ID for pre-approved loans Preapproved PLUS Loan credit check process Response file upload Change transaction processing Hold/Release control based on disbursement eligibility edits Electronic funds transfer and paper check processing with aging and exception reports Automated paper check or EFT returns to lenders 28

31 Direct Loans Create loan originations in batch or online Promissory note, manifest, and disclosure statement printing Full Participant XML COD extract and import: Origination and disbursement information Student and parent borrower identifier data Change transaction data (with student level logging) Entrance/exit counseling import updates online form and tracking requirements Statement of account import and online display Comparison process captures data for use with federal reconciliation software 31

38 Student Employment Record referrals to hiring departments (optional) Authorize federal, state, institutionally funded students to work Multiple position number/departmental assignments Varying wage amounts On-campus and off-campus work locations Automated payroll wage load or manual entry of wages Payroll exception report of unauthorized student workers Payroll history form for all student workers Wage posting to Financial Aid award and budget control forms Departmental and administrator level earnings reports 38

42 Return of Title IV Refund Process Banner Student Procedures Withdraw student official or unofficial code Create withdrawal form with calculation information Banner Financial Aid Procedures Create Return to Title IV calculation form and confirm award/return information Manually adjust amounts on award form Run Disbursement Process to recoup award amounts and generate student account entry Print copy of calculation and send to student Banner Accounts Receivable Procedures Process refunds as needed 42

44 Satisfactory Academic Progress Determine SAP status codes and the aid that each will impact Write rules to identify students who: Exceed 150% federal limits Meet quantitative and qualitative SAP standards Fail quantitative and qualitative SAP standards Establish translations to move students through a status progression automatically Run SAP process in batch or online Schedule SAP notification letters automatically 44

46 Tracking and Award Letters Package or adjust awards Post tracking requirements Run population selection process Extract variables for the selected students Create merge file, recipient list, and Banner log records Send Paper or Correspondence using merge file Reset tracking or award letter indicators if included in population selection criteria 46
